Where are Four Starlings products made?
All our products are entirely handcrafted in our own manufacturing facility and laboratory in Białystok, Poland. We hold the EU G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ice) certification, ensuring the highest safety and quality standards. Products are made fresh and shipped directly to you without sitting in long-term inventory.

Are your products natural?
Yes! We pride ourselves on keeping things simple and natural. Our products contain 98% - 100% natural origin ingredients, relying on cold-pressed oils, unrefined butters, essential oils, and botanical extracts. You will never find artificial fragrances, parabens, or SLS/SLES in our formulas.

Are the products vegan and cruelty-free?
We are strictly a cruelty-free brand—we never test on animals. The vast majority of our products are 100% vegan. A very small number of items may contain natural animal by-products like beeswax or lanolin, which are always clearly stated on the ingredient list.

Are your products safe for pregnant and breastfeeding women?
Our products are formulated with mild, natural ingredients. However, because some of our products contain pure essential oils (such as rosemary or cedarwood), we recommend that pregnant and breastfeeding women consult with their doctor before use, or opt for our gentle, essential-oil-free "Unscented" product range.

Is there an adjustment period for natural shampoo bars?
If you are transitioning from commercial liquid shampoos to our natural shampoo bars for the first time, your hair might experience a short transition period (2-3 washes). Lather the bar in your hands first, then massage the foam into your scalp. Pair it with a natural conditioner, and your hair will soon feel incredibly light and voluminous!

What is the expiration date of your natural skincare products?
Because we do not use harsh synthetic preservatives, our natural products have a slightly shorter shelf life. Unopened products generally last 12-24 months. Once opened, we recommend using them within 3-6 months for maximum efficacy and freshness. Please check the EXP date on the bottom of the packaging.

How should I store my soap and shampoo bars?
To extend the life of your handcrafted bars, always keep them on a well-draining soap dish. Allow them to dry completely between uses, and keep them away from direct sunlight and stagnant water.

Is your packaging eco-friendly?
Absolutely. "Zero Waste" is a practice we live by. We actively eliminate unnecessary plastics from our supply chain. You will find our products housed in recyclable glass jars, reusable aluminum tins, and biodegradable paper packaging. We highly encourage upcycling our beautiful jars and tins!
